Joker Powerboats/CRC 611 Race Report.

The Joker Powerboat/CRC 611 race team came away with a hard fought victory in the International Offshore Powerboat Race held this past weekend. The event was held in the St. Clair River between Port Huron, Michigan and Sarnia, Canada, making it the only powerboat race on the Offshore Powerboat Racing Association's schedule that crosses national borders. The event, part of the Amsoil Offshore Powerboat Racing Series brought the speed and excitement of powerboat racing to an international audience.

The team battled 8 other boats in the largest class of the event competing 7 laps for a total of 35 miles on the turbulent waters of the river. It is their first victory of the season as well as the first race started as the boat was damaged in pre race testing during the first event in Ocean City, Maryland.
